Output 18e23b06314eb04c6353376ed91c0cbc660101906be11c367b8ed2ff4d50fc32:344

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 10305614039bcf8d635daa63d2eef0810c9fd5cda3ef49c38cfe8cca2ded9839
address
tb1pzqc9v9qrn08c6c6a4f3a9mhssyxfl4wd50h5nsuvl6xv5t0dnqusthtwzy
transaction
18e23b06314eb04c6353376ed91c0cbc660101906be11c367b8ed2ff4d50fc32